SD, to me feminism doesn't mean that women are always right. It merely asks for equal legal, social and economic rights for them. Yes, current attitude of women themselves is terrible. But isn't that a product of patriarchy? Most of us simply reaffirm those values without thinking that we are, in effect, hurting ourselves (women as a group). I'll equate it to the freedom struggle - if feminism is the struggle for freedom, the women we are talking about are the Indian middle class who depended upon the British for their livelihood, while the (male and female) feminists are satyagrahis 😃 This is how I think of it.
